What is a Webhook and How is it Related to SEO?
venkatesan murugan
Digital Marketing Lead | Google Ads Specialist | E-Commerce | B2B Consultant
In the world of web development and automation, webhooks are an essential tool that allows different applications to communicate with each other in real-time. But how does this tie into SEO (Search Engine Optimization)? Let's dive into both concepts and explore their connection.
What is a Webhook?
A webhook is essentially a user-defined HTTP callback that allows one system to send real-time data to another system as soon as an event occurs. It is a lightweight, efficient way for one system to notify another without the need for constant polling or manual checking.
How Webhooks Work:
For example, when a new blog post is published on your site, a webhook can send that information to a connected social media tool, automatically sharing the post with your audience.
Benefits of Webhooks:
How Webhooks Are Related to SEO
At first glance, webhooks and SEO (Search Engine Optimization) might not seem directly connected. However, in today’s rapidly evolving digital landscape, webhooks can play a key role in enhancing SEO strategies, particularly when it comes to content updates, site management, and automation.
Here’s how webhooks are relevant to SEO:
1. Automated Content Syndication
For SEO purposes, fresh, relevant content is crucial to improving rankings. Webhooks can automate the process of sharing newly published blog posts or content updates with other platforms like social media, content syndication networks, or even other websites.
2. Real-Time Indexing with Search Engines
Search engines like Google frequently crawl websites to discover and index new content. Webhooks can be used to notify search engines when new content is live on a site, prompting faster indexing.
领英推荐
3. Enhanced Website Monitoring
Maintaining a healthy website is crucial for SEO. Webhooks can be used to integrate website monitoring tools that track important metrics like page load times, uptime, or broken links. These monitoring systems can alert you instantly when a problem occurs, allowing you to fix issues before they negatively affect SEO.
4. Analytics and Data Tracking Automation
SEO is all about understanding your data—traffic, keywords, user behavior, etc. Webhooks can integrate SEO tools like Google Analytics, SEMrush, or Ahrefs with your website to send SEO-related data instantly to your dashboards or reporting tools.
5. Product Updates for E-commerce Websites
If you run an eCommerce website, having accurate product listings is essential for SEO. Webhooks can be used to automatically update your product catalog across various platforms, ensuring that any new products, price changes, or stock availability are reflected in real time, which can directly impact SEO rankings.
6. SEO Audits and Alerts
A regular SEO audit is necessary to track technical SEO aspects such as broken links, slow page speeds, and meta tag issues. Webhooks can automate alerts when these issues arise, providing real-time notifications and enabling you to fix problems promptly.
Real-World SEO Use Case:
Imagine you're running a blog on WordPress, and you’ve set up webhooks to automate some key SEO tasks. When a new post is published:
Conclusion
Webhooks are powerful tools for automating workflows, ensuring that your SEO efforts are faster and more efficient. By leveraging webhooks, you can improve the speed of indexing, automate content sharing, track SEO performance in real-time, and fix technical issues before they impact your site’s ranking.
In today’s digital world, where real-time data and automation are key to staying competitive, webhooks offer a way to optimize your SEO efforts while freeing up your time for other critical tasks. Whether you’re running a blog, an eCommerce site, or an enterprise-level website, integrating webhooks into your SEO strategy can help you gain a competitive edge in search engine rankings.